Cisco has announced that it will acquire Acacia Communications for 2.6 billion dollars (2.3 billion euros). Acacia Communications provides optical interconnect technology to Cisco.

Acacia Communications develops algorithms for processing digital signals, writes ZDNet. It also creates technology for ASIC design and verification, software, integration and optics optimization.

Technology woven into the Cisco portfolio

Cisco pays $70 per share for Acacia Communications. The supplier’s existing customers will continue to be supported after the takeover. New customers can also use Acacia Communications products that are used in network equipment.

The company claims to have acquired Acacia Communications as it can use the company’s technology throughout its network portfolio targeting cloud providers, service providers and enterprises.

The acquisition is expected to be completed in the second half of the current fiscal year. Acacia Communications is then part of the Optical Systems department of Cisco.

Sentryo SAS

The acquisition of Acacia Communications is the second for Cisco in a short time. In June it was announced that the company also acquired the French provider of cybersecurity solutions for industrial control systems (ICS) Sentryo SAS.

Sentryo SAS has ICS CyberVision as its main product. This gives engineers complete visibility over all equipment connected to their industrial networks. Vulnerabilities on those networks are identified by the service. It can also take decisions that can ensure the integrity of the systems.

By combining Ciscos intent-based networking architecture with Sentryo’s capabilities, customers can capture IT benefits, manage networks and devices on a scale and enable collaboration between IT and AT departments, and better protect their assets and data,” said Rob Salvagno, vice president of corporate development and investments.

There was also cooperation with Sentryo SAS for the acquisition. Sentryo SAS’ Edge Sensor and Cisco’s industrial networking hardware are integrated into Cisco’s IOx application framework. The acquisition of Sentryo SAS is expected to be completed in the first fiscal quarter of Cisco. That quarter closes on October 26th.
